This buck was taken back in 1961 near my home. The 1964 B@C book gives this buck a net score of 192 6/8. The deer was a 8 by 5 taken by a Franlin Hollinger (sp?). I think he was from Harrisburg, PA.
I found the sheds in 1988 and 1991 within a mile of where the buck was shot. The shed with the two cheaters scores 84 4/8 on the frame and several inches are chewed off. The other shed scores 82 4/8. My brother found the match to the bigger antler in 1981 but unfortunately all of the points were chewed off. I found the match to the smaller antler in 1991 but all that was left was the bace to the main fork. I spotted the smaller antler at 800 yard under some juniper trees. I had to use the spotting scope to make sure my 10 power bino. were not lieing to me. I luckest find of my life.
This is one of the biggest bucks to ever come out of my aria. I would sure like to locate this buck. If any of you have any Info on this buck please let me know.
